Australian Development Gateway

The Australian Development Gateway (ADG) strives to support members of the development community in their efforts to reduce poverty and enhance sustainable development in the Asia Pacific region. The site has been created with participation from members of government, private, academia and non-government organisations. User feedback mechanisms have been incorporated to guide future directions of the site. The site is optimised for low bandwidth access to enable the widest participation throughout the Asia Pacific region.

Transport infrastructure and poverty reduction: experiences of Bangladesh (pdf 100kb)

This paper explores the linkages between transport infrastructure and poverty reduction in Bangladesh.

It provides an overview of the poverty context in Bangladesh, national poverty reduction initiatives by the Government, and the role of infrastructure in contributing to poverty reduction.
 
The paper also describes evidence from the Southwest Road Development Network Project showing how improved access to road networks led to reduced poverty in the project area.
